Aquí es fa una mostra de comandes que es van usant
- sudo chmod -R 777 /volume2. La comanda
sudo
és una abreviació de “superuser do” o “switch user do”. Es tracta d’una comanda que permet als usuaris executar tasques amb privilegis d’administrador o superusuari (root) en sistemes Unix i Linux.Quan utilitzessudo
, introdueixes la teva contrasenya per demostrar que tens permisos per realitzar una acció específica. Això és útil per a tasques que requereixen permisos especials, com instal·lar paquets, modificar fitxers de sistema o executar comandes que afecten tot el sistema. La comandachmod -R 777
és una comanda que s’utilitza per canviar els permisos d’un fitxer o directori en sistemes Unix i Linux. - ———–
- Canviar el nom d’un fitxer: mv /volume2/dateutil_env/wsgi.py /volume2/dateutil_env/wsgi-old.py
- ——————-
- Moure el fitxer: mv /volume2/web/0-python/test_app.py /volume2/dateutil_env/
ASGI vs. WSGI (Enllaç)
2. Trobar on és un fitxer per exemple apache2.4-> ls -la /var/packages/Apache2.4/
urqtejmi@synology_vall:/volume2/dateutil_env$ ls -la /var/packages/Apache2.4/
total 64
- Entrar en un entorn virtual: Navega fins al directori de l’entorn virtual:
cd /volume2/dateutil_env
(per exemple poden haver molts entorns virtuals) - Activa l’entorn virtual:
source bin/activate
Després d’activar l’entorn, el prompt de la línia de comandes hauria de canviar per indicar que estàs dins de l’entorn virtual, per exemple: urqtejmi@synology_vall:/volume2/dateutil_env$ source bin/activate - (dateutil_env) urqtejmi@synology_vall:/volume2/dateutil_env$ i per sortir :(dateutil_env) urqtejmi@synology_vall:/volume2/dateutil_env$ deactivate urqtejmi@synology_vall:/volume2/dateutil_env
- ——————————————————————————
- Cerca un fitxer: Un cop connectat, utilitza la comanda
find
per buscar el fitxer o la carpetadateutil_env
. Per exemple:find / -name "dateutil_env"
es pot delimitar la recercafind /volume2
. Si hi ha problemes amb els permisos:sudo find /volume2 -name "dateutil_env"
- Què es un entorn Virtual? Un entorn virtual és un espai digital simulat on els usuaris poden interactuar amb objectes, eines i informació, sovint de manera remota o a través de dispositius electrònics1. En el context de la programació, un entorn virtual de Python és una eina que ajuda a mantenir les dependències necessàries per a un projecte en un lloc aïllat, evitant conflictes amb altres projectes.